Buying a Double Pushchair For Twins Or Two Siblings Close in Age?

baby-jogger-city-tour-2-double-travel-pushchair-lightweight-foldable-portable-double-buggy-pitch-black-94.jpg?If you have twins or two kids close in age, a double pushchair offers the flexibility you need to accommodate your growing family. Select from tandem models or side-by-side configurations like the Mountain Buggy Duet V3 which is narrow enough to fit standard doorways.

Many models are compatible with infant car seats and include reclining seats. Some models can even be converted to single mode, as with the egg2 Pushchair that is loved for its style and versatility.

Side by Side

Side-by-side strollers are an excellent option for families with twins or siblings of various ages. These typically offer 2 fixed seats with a single canopy, and are usually larger than an inline buggy, which gives each child the same view. They are simple to maneuver and even come with front and back suspension for better handling when going over bumps or kerbs.

They can be more expensive than other double buggies, but they have a better selling price, particularly when they're a well-known brand. They're also ideal for jogging, and can handle rough terrain, while the seats offer plenty of space for your children to comfortably sit. When comparing double pushchairs, consider the weight of each frame, seat and suspension. The heavier the buggy heavier, the more difficult it will be to push. This is especially the case on uneven surfaces. Check the dimensions of the folding and whether or not it's possible to remove the seats, making it more compact. Look for features like a simple one-handed fold, that home tester Kirstie described as "genius" and a useful strap that you can wear over your shoulders.

You can also opt for a tandem pushchair that places children behind each other. It is not as maneuverable, but still a great option for families with multiple children. It might be more suitable for older toddlers. You'll also find some tandems that have reclining seats which give children the flexibility to lie down or sit and stand double stroller down based on their mood and needs.

Some double pushchairs only allow you to seat your children side by side and are generally oriented towards the world. However there are some notable exceptions like the Bugaboo Donkey or Mountain Buggy Duet which can be configured with both front and parent facing (though this can increase the overall width of the chassis). Tandems are typically more maneuverable through kerbs, but they it can be a struggle to navigate through narrow doors and aisles.
